Read more from Mail Online   Skipping breakfast can lead to increased risk of heart attack study finds A study of older men found those who regularly skipped breakfast
had a 27 percent higher risk of a heart attack than those who ate a morning meal. There's no reason why the results wouldn't apply to other people, too, the Harvard researchers said.
